Output 8802e529e18c36b0577000ee43874dc57453215b9eb51b43913f1f69c1e63dd0:1

value
8593740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9f8386643d410043cf1843d5a3525069219d2a7 OP_EQUAL
address
3JeLHgWBUZ7v4aeyhst4gWsviiRVJoFrET
transaction
8802e529e18c36b0577000ee43874dc57453215b9eb51b43913f1f69c1e63dd0
confirmations
306150
spent
true